Spelling suggestions: "subject:"ciências dda computação"" "subject:"ciências daa computação""
151 |
Correlacionamento estéreo de complexidade linear baseado em indexação de regiõesOliveira, Marco Antonio Floriano de January 2006 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-graduação em Ciência da Computação / Made available in DSpace on 2012-10-22T16:21:29Z (GMT). No. of bitstreams: 1
233629.pdf: 3766536 bytes, checksum: e109e6ae29ea4b6b75e0b93be252f0eb (MD5) / Este trabalho apresenta um método de complexidade linear para correlacionamento estéreo de tempo-real, no qual o tempo de processamento depende apenas da resolução do par de imagens. Regiões ao longo de cada linha epipolar são indexadas para produzir o mapa de disparidades, ao invés de realizar uma busca pela melhor correlação. Métodos locais atuais não possuem complexidade linear, uma vez que dependem de uma busca através de um espaço de possíveis correlações. O método apresentado é limitado a um conjunto de câmeras paralelas ou um par de imagens retificadas, porque todas as disparidades devem ocorrer na mesma direção e sentido. Uma restrição de continuidade é aplicada para remover falsas correlações. O mapa resultante é semi-denso, mas as disparidades são bem distribuídas e as áreas esparsas são preenchidas satisfatoriamente através de interpolação baseada no ponto mais próximo. Nenhum ajuste específico de parâmetros é necessário. Resultados experimentais com conjuntos de dados padrão alcançam aproximadamente 90% de acurácia, usando metodologia de teste bem conhecida e os mesmos parâmetros em todos os testes.
|
152 |
Um método para detecção de intrusão em grades computacionaisSchulter, Alexandre January 2006 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ência da Computação. / Made available in DSpace on 2012-10-22T18:23:08Z (GMT). No. of bitstreams: 1
228795.pdf: 833848 bytes, checksum: 1aa6d11f42af74cd0f0465fe237c4121 (MD5) / As tecnologias atuais de detecção de intrusão são limitadas na proteção contra ataques que podem violar a segurança de grades computacionais. Este trabalho apresenta o problema da detecção de intrusão em grades, descreve os requisitos para identificar essas violações, propõe um método para detecção de intrusão baseada em grade, descreve um exemplo de uma arquitetura de um sistema de detecção de intrusão (IDS) distribuído e mostra como ele supera as limitações das tecnologias atuais pela integração da detecção dos ataques típicos de computadores host e de redes com a detecção de ataques específicos de grade e anomalias de comportamento de usuários. A integração é viabilizada pelo uso de protocolos e formatos de compartilhamento de informações entre IDSs que estão em processo de padronização pelo IETF. É também descrito um caso de uso empregando simulação de uma grade computacional onde usuários que apresentam anomalias comportamentais são identificados por um IDS de grade integrado com outros IDSs que aprendeu previamente a reconhecer mudanças de comportamento que possivelmente são o resultado de uma intrusão.
|
153 |
Modelo de um Núcleo de Sistema Operacional Extensível utilizando reflexão computacionalImmich, Roger Kreutz January 2006 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ência da Computação. / Made available in DSpace on 2012-10-22T20:54:40Z (GMT). No. of bitstreams: 1
233435.pdf: 488451 bytes, checksum: ff65c6feee0e30911e3fc39d28896d1a (MD5) / A concepção de computadores cada vez mais poderosos, com mais recursos e funcionalidades impulsionou uma significativa evolução no desenvolvimento de sistemas operacionais. Estes sistemas, com o objetivo de prover acesso aos dispositivos, implementam uma complexa abstração do hardware, permitindo que as aplicações sejam projetadas em uma camada de alto nível, facilitando o desenvolvimento e aumentando a portabilidade. Esta abordagem é eficiente nos casos citados acima, porém ela produz um gerenciador de recursos fortemente centralizado, que pode entrar em conflito com as necessidades específicas das aplicações, limitando-as tanto em performance quanto em flexibilidade, devido ao fato de que a aplicação precisa se adaptar ao ambiente de execução. De acordo com autores conceituados, a necessidade da adaptação do sistema operacional em relação a aplicação é cada vez mais evidente e somente desta forma será possível oferecer um ambiente especializado de acordo com as necessidades específicas de cada uma delas. O modelo proposto neste trabalho, visa suprir estas necessidades, oferecendo a possibilidade da modificação do ambiente de execução através de meta-informações passadas pelas aplicações no momento da sua inicialização ou dinamicamente durante a sua execução. Através das simulações realizadas, foi provado que é possível a concepção de tal arquitetura, contudo ainda é muito dependente de recursos que estão sendo desenvolvidos e aprimorados, como a máquina virtual Java.
The increase conception of more powerful computers, with better resources and functionalities, began to stimulate a significant evolution in the operation system development. These systems provide devices access by implementing one complex hardware abstraction layer, allowing that the applications can be developed in a high level layer, which help to quick development and portability increase. This strategy is efficient in the cited cases above, however it produces a strong centered resources management, which can conflict with the application specific necessities, limiting them in performance and flexibility, because the application has to adapt yourself to an execution environment. Some authors with appraised, has been talk about the necessity of the operational system adaptation in relation to the application and it have been more evident, maybe this could be the only way to offer a specialized environment in agreement with the application specific necessities. The approach present in this thesis, aims at to supply dynamically these necessities, offering the modification possibility in the environment through meta-information passed by the applications at the load-time or run-time. Through simulations, was demonstrated that the conception of such architecture is possible, however this approach still dependent of the resources that are being in development and improvement, as the Java virtual machine.
|
154 |
Uma abordagem de modelagem de processos suportada por um guia de referência alinhado ao CMMI-DEV, MPS.BR e ISO/IEC 15504Hauck, Jean Carlo Rossa January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ência de Computação. / Made available in DSpace on 2012-10-23T02:13:53Z (GMT). No. of bitstreams: 1
251945.pdf: 8427087 bytes, checksum: d1559991538a79d7f11b0b65b4778a98 (MD5) / Existem diversos modelos e normas de referência para a melhoria de processos de software disponíveis atualmente, mas as Micro e Pequenas Empresas (MPEs) de software em geral não os conhecem ou não os utilizam e acabam enfrentando dificuldades em produzir software com a qualidade e produtividade esperadas pelo mercado. Percebe-se a ausência de indicações concretas de implementação das práticas sugeridas pelos modelos e normas de referência para que possam ser aplicadas à realidade das MPEs. Além de atender às características das MPEs em geral, essas práticas precisam ser adaptadas às especificidades de cada organização e alinhadas aos seus objetivos de negócio por meio da modelagem de processo. Nesse contexto, este trabalho apresenta a extensão da abordagem de modelagem de processos ASPE/MSC, por meio da introdução de um guia de referência de processo alinhado aos principais
modelos de referência e adaptado às características e limitações típicas das MPEs. Um guia de referência para o processo de monitoramento e controle de projetos é elaborado e, embutido na abordagem ASPE/MSC estendida, é aplicado na modelagem desse processo em duas rganizações. Nestas duas aplicações foram coletadas diversas experiências. A avaliação destas duas aplicações estabelece uma primeira indicação de que a utilização de um guia de referência durante a modelagem de processos pode auxiliar na eficiência da modelagem do processo, reduzindo o esforço e o tempo necessários. Também é possível observar que o suporte de um guia de referência pode auxiliar o engenheiro de processo, fornecendo suporte concreto durante a modelagem do processo.
Currently, there exist several models and standards for software processes improvement currently available, but, in general, Micro and Small software Companies (MSC) do not know or do not use th em, with the result that they face difficulties in producing software with quality and productivity as expected by the market. There can be perceived a lack of indications on how to the implement practices suggested by reference models and standards adapted to the reality of MSC. In addition, those practices have to be adapted to the specific characteristics of each organization and aligned with their business goals through process modeling. In this context, this work presents an extension of the ASPE/MSC processes modeling approach, through the introduction of a process reference guide as a basis for the improvement of a descriptive process model in alignment with well-known reference models and adapted to typical MSC characteristics and limitations. In this context, a guide for the process project monitoring and control is created and, using the ASPE/MSC extension, applied in two software organizations. In these two applications were collected various experiences. The evaluation of these two applications provide first indicators that the use of a reference guide for process modeling may help the efficiency, reducing the effort and time required. We also observe that the support of a reference guide may help the engineer during the modeling process.
|
155 |
DIInCXRodrigues, Khaue Rezende January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-graduação em Ciência da Computação / Made available in DSpace on 2012-10-23T03:22:05Z (GMT). No. of bitstreams: 1
247095.pdf: 533421 bytes, checksum: b56ea5d764d04f11d2eda8019c147fa2 (MD5) / A Web tem sido adotada como uma grande fonte e meio para troca de informações. No entanto, os dados presentes nela se encontram sob os mais variados modelos de dados, principalmente XML. Em função do amplo uso do modelo de dados XML, questões como a descoberta de conhecimento e a manutenção da integridade sobre dados XML têm crescido em importância. A descoberta de conhecimento é relevante no suporte a decisões, enquanto a manutenção da integridade visa manter este conhecimento consistente. Dada esta relevância, é proposta uma abordagem semi-automática para descoberta de Restrições de Integridade Semânticas (RIS) a partir de instâncias XML chamada DIInCX (Discovery of Implicit Integrity Constraint from XML data).
DIInCX define um processo que coleta informações sobre as instâncias XML, aplica um algoritmo de mineração de regras de associação com adaptações e traduz as regras descobertas para RIS's especificadas na linguagem SWRL (Semantic Web Rule Language). A abordagem provê suporte a sistemas de manipulação de dados que desejam gerenciar RIS's. Outra contribuição deste trabalho é uma taxionomia para RIS's XML segundo os componentes de uma RI em bancos de dados. Esta taxionomia auxilia na avaliação de expressividade de linguagens de especificação de RIS's XML e da robustez de sistemas que controlam RIS's
|
156 |
Uma arquitetura para submissão de aplicações de dispositivos móveis e embarcados para uma configuração de grade computacionalRolim, Carlos Oberdan January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ência da Computação. / Made available in DSpace on 2012-10-23T04:11:35Z (GMT). No. of bitstreams: 1
241992.pdf: 947224 bytes, checksum: 44c6ee182bfc9c0ca61422264262ba13 (MD5)
|
157 |
Interconectando sensores com transparência numa rede de sensores sem fio segura dividida em clustersMenezes, Alexandre Gava January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ência da Computação / Made available in DSpace on 2012-10-23T05:28:42Z (GMT). No. of bitstreams: 1
238943.pdf: 1240041 bytes, checksum: dfd3574d78bb7a18cb321e50c5c1d57d (MD5) / Uma rede de sensores sem fio é uma coleção de dispositivos limitados em poder de processamento e alcance de transmissão, com baixa disponibilidade de memória e de energia. Devido a estas limitações, a maioria das soluções de segurança de redes cabeadas, tais como baseadas em ICP pura, não se aplicam diretamente neste tipo de ambiente. Este trabalho apresenta um protocolo híbrido que trata do esquema de gerenciamento de chaves e da interconexão transparente de clusters. Também é tratado o problema de captura de nós, oferecendo uma solução para a proteção da chave de grupo. Simulações mostram que aumentando o número de sensores na rede, o desempenho da comunicação entre dois clusters quaisquer permanece o mesmo
|
158 |
Geração automática de diagramas de comunicação a partir de contratos OCLSantos, Claumir Claudino dos January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duaçõa em Ciência da Computação. / Made available in DSpace on 2012-10-23T05:34:18Z (GMT). No. of bitstreams: 0Bitstream added on 2013-07-16T20:06:07Z : No. of bitstreams: 1
249954.pdf: 0 bytes, checksum: d41d8cd98f00b204e9800998ecf8427e (MD5) / Este trabalho apresenta um conjunto de princípios que, se aplicados para a definição de contratos de operações de sistema, possibilitam a geração automática de diagramas de comunicação (UML). Os diagramas assim gerados podem ser usados também para geração automática de código.
O mecanismo que gera os diagramas de comunicação é um sistema de busca, o qual foi projetado para encontrar diagramas que realizam um contrato de acordo com os padrões de projeto GRASP - General Responsibility Assignment Software Patterns. Os contratos são escritos em uma linguagem que consiste em uma variação da OCL (Object Constraint Language) adaptada para representar explicitamente os cinco tipos de pós-condições semânticas possíveis em modelos orientados a objetos. Apesar de seu considerável poder de geração, o mecanismo de busca resume-se a um conjunto de apenas quatro regras.
O sistema foi implementado e testado em diversos contratos típicos de sistemas de informação, produzindo em todos os casos os resultados almejados. Estes resultados podem ser generalizados também para contratos mais complexos.
|
159 |
Uma lógica para a referência ambíguaSebben, Andressa January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ência da Computação. / Made available in DSpace on 2012-10-23T06:44:37Z (GMT). No. of bitstreams: 1
247160.pdf: 935971 bytes, checksum: 3be79a9c89f8cf419503feef85d5261e (MD5) / Descritores são operadores que formam termos a partir de variáveis e fórmulas de sistemas lógicos. Diversas teorias introduzem descritores para representar, em linguagens formais, o artigo definido (o/a) e o artigo indefinido (um/uma) das linguagens naturais. Entretanto, as abordagens mais conhecidas não oferecem um tratamento para termos ambíguos. A lógica LAR (Logic of Ambiguous Reference), originalmente apresentada em Buchsbaum(2002), foi proposta para representar adequadamente estas situações, bastante comuns na matemática e na linguagem cotidiana. LAR apresenta um modo diferenciado de tratar descrições, através da associação de cada termo a uma coleção de objetos do universo de discurso, em oposição às semânticas usuais, as quais associam cada termo a um único objeto. Dessa forma, pode-se tratar uniformemente descrições unívocas, vácuas ou ambíguas. Outra característica de destaque é o conceito de abrangência, o qual opera como uma igualdade unidirecional. Essas duas características, descrição e abrangência, permitem uma representação de conhecimento mais próxima da prática lingüística usual. Este trabalho apresenta um detalhamento de LAR, incluindo provas dos resultados originais e algumas correções, além da apresentação de diversos exemplos. Por fim, LAR é comparada às lógicas descritivas de Bertrand Russell, de John Barkley Rosser e de David Hilbert.
|
160 |
Gerência do consumo de energia dirigida pela aplicação em sistemas embarcadosHoeller Junior, Arliones Stevert January 2007 (has links)
Dissertação (mestrado) - Universidade Federal de Santa Catarina, Centro Tecnológico. Programa de Pós-Graduação em Ciência da Computação. / Made available in DSpace on 2012-10-23T08:42:37Z (GMT). No. of bitstreams: 1
240542.pdf: 743159 bytes, checksum: 946b8886de1ead1988e790461ac40938 (MD5) / Baixo consumo de energia é um dos principais requisitos no projeto de sistemas embarcados, principalmente quando estes são alimentados por baterias. Técnicas que têm sido aplicadas com eficácia em sistemas de computação genérica não têm atingido o mesmo êxito em sistemas embarcados, ou devido à falta de flexibilidade, ou devido aos requisitos para sua implantação (volumes de memória e processamento), que podem tornar proibitiva sua aplicação nestes dispositivos. Este trabalho define uma interface simples e uniforme para gerência de energia dirigida pela aplicação em sistemas embarcados. Esta interface disponibiliza ao programador da aplicação a flexibilidade de configurar os modos de operação de baixo consumo dos componentes em uso, conforme sua necessidade. A implementação buscou garantir a portabilidade desta aplicação a um baixo custo em termos de uso de memória e processamento. Este trabalho utiliza Redes de Petri Hierárquicas para especificar os procedimentos de troca de modos de operação dos componentes, utilizando os pontos de refinamento destas redes para representar as relações entre os diversos componentes do sistema. O uso das Redes de Petri permitiu analisar o mecanismo de gerência de energia para verificar seu funcionamento e a inexistência de impasses. A extensão da interface dos componentes e a inclusão dos procedimentos de troca de modo de operação foram implementadas como um aspecto. Um protótipo foi desenvolvido utilizando o sistema operacional Embedded Parallel Operating System (EPOS) e estudos de caso foram realizados para demonstrar a usabilidade desta interface.
|
Page generated in 0.3318 seconds